Party Affiliation: In Texas, there are two main ways for a voter to affiliate with a party: by being accepted to vote in a party's primary election or by taking an oath of affiliation . A registered voter is not required to pre-register or take any steps towards affiliating themselves with a party before voting in a party's primary election.
